Magainins, also known as PGS (peptide glycine serine) are anti-microbial peptides originally isolated from the skin of the African clawed frog Xenopus laevis, they belong to a large family of amphibian amphipathic alpha-helical cationic anti-microbial peptides (CAMPs). Magainin I is active against a wide spectrum of pathogens including Gram-positive and Gram-negative bacteria, fungi and protozoa and has anti-viral properties against HIV and herpes simplex virus. Magainins also displays anti-tumour activities and are known to facilitate wound closure and to reduce inflammation.Magainin peptides act by first binding to and then causing eventual collapse of the membrane. Magainins, carry several positive charges, and interact best with membranes with a negative surface charge, such as bacteria or tumour cells. However they are non-toxic to healthy eukaryotic cells which are charge-neutral at their outer membrane. The physical mode of action of these peptides reduces the ability of target organisms to develop resistance to them, suggesting good therapeutic potential.Couleur et forme :PowderMasse moléculaire :2,321.3 g/molCRAMP (6-39)

This peptide is phosphorylated by Janus kinase 2 and 3 (JAK2 and JAK3) and is an ideal substrate for use in kinase assays. The JAK family of kinases is essential for the signalling of a host of immune modulators in tumour, stromal, and immune cells where they are highly expressed. JAK family proteins mediate the signalling of the interferon (IFN), IL-6, and IL-2 families of cytokines.JAK kinases are associated with cytokine receptors. Cytokine binding to these receptors results in activation of JAK kinases and receptor phosphorylation. Phosphorylated cytokine receptors recruit STAT proteins, which are then phosphorylated by the activated JAK kinases. Phosphorylated STAT proteins form homo- and hetero-dimers that translocate into the nucleus and function as transcription factors.This peptide contains an N-terminal Alexa Fluor 647 florescent dye. A cysteine residue has been added to the N-terminus for conjugation of the dye via the cysteine thiol moiety. AF647 is a bright, far-red-fluorescent dye with excitation between 594 nm and 633 nm, and is pH-insensitive over a wide molar range.Angiotensin III, human

Alyerserin-2a is a C-terminally α-amidated 17 residue cationic anti-microbial peptide (AMP). Anti-microbial peptides (AMPs) are produced by the innate immune system and are expressed when the host is challenged by a pathogen. The Alyerserin family of peptides was first identified in norepinephrine-stimulated skin secretions of the midwife toad-Alytes obstetricans-(Alytidae). Alyteserin-2a, 2b and -2c show some sequence identity with bombinin H6, a peptide from the skins Bombinatoridae family of frogs.Alyteserin-2a is most potent against the Gram-positive bacteria-Staphylococcus aureus and has weak haemolytic activity against human erythrocytes.Alyteserin contain at least 50% hydrophobic amino acids. Hydrophobic residues contribute to the insertion of the peptide into the hydrophobic membrane core which results in membrane disruption and death of the pathogen. Due to their mechanism of action it is thought to be less likely for resistance to develop towards them compared to conventional antibiotics. Alyteserin-2a has the tendency to adopt an α-helical conformation between residues 9-14 when in membrane-mimetic solvent.

Magainin-1 is a 23-amino acids peptide which belongs to the magainin peptide family. Magainins are antibiotic peptides with antibacterial, antiviral and antifungal activities. These peptides cause perturbation of membrane functions responsible for osmotic balance. Magainin-1 carries out its antibacterial activity by folding to an amphiphilic helix to interact specifically with lipidic bilayer, resulting in a permeability change. Magainin-1 has broad-spectrum, non-specific activity against a wide range of micro-organisms including viruses as HSV-1 and HSV-2, gram-positive and gram-negative bacteria, protozoa, yeasts and fungi. Magainin-1 may also be hemolytic and cytotoxic to cancer cells. Besides its antimicrobial activity, Magainin-1 presents an antifungal activity against some pathogens such as Candida Albicans with a antifungal activity of 4.15 uM. Recently, it has also been shown that magainin-1 can induce apoptosis of some leukemia cells at a concentration of 10 to 50 nM.Formule :C112H177N29O28SDegré de pureté :Min. 95%Masse moléculaire :2,409.9 g/molLEAP-2 (38-77) (Human)

Beta-Defensin-1 (BD-1) is an antimicrobial peptide that is produced by various cells and tissues in mice, including epithelial cells in the skin, lungs, and intestines. BD-1 is a member of the beta-defensin family, which are small cationic peptides that play a role in innate immunity by protecting against microbial pathogens, including bacteria, fungi, and viruses. In mice, BD-1 is constitutively expressed, meaning that it is produced at a relatively constant level in healthy animals. Its expression can be induced by various stimuli, including bacterial and viral infections, cytokines, and inflammatory mediators. BD-1 is known to have broad-spectrum antimicrobial activity against a variety of pathogens, including Staphylococcus aureus, Pseudomonas aeruginosa, and Candida albicans. It achieves its antimicrobial activity by disrupting the cell membranes of the pathogens, leading to cell lysis and death. In addition to its antimicrobial activity, BD-1 has been found to have other functions in mice, including promoting wound healing, regulating inflammation, and modulating the immune response.Formule :C168H266N52O54S6Degré de pureté :Min. 95%Masse moléculaire :4,070.6 g/molFmoc-Dbz
